Parks Supervisor
The City of Sonoma is seeking a highly qualified, dynamic, and enthusiastic professional to join its leadership team as Parks Supervisor in the Parks & Recreation Department. This position oversees the Parks, Cemeteries, and Facilities Division, supervising a team of five staff and working closely with colleagues to support special events, arts & culture, and recreation initiatives that enrich community life.
The Parks Supervisor manages day-to-day maintenance and operations of the City’s parks, cemeteries, open spaces, and facilities, ensuring they remain safe, functional, and welcoming for residents and visitors alike. The role also includes budget administration, contractor oversight, and occasional evening and weekend work to support City events.
The ideal candidate will bring expertise in parks and facilities operations, hands-on supervisory experience, and a strong commitment to customer service, teamwork, and public service.
